一、基本功能 git commit是Git版本控制系统的核心命令,用于将代码更改提交到本地仓库中。 每次提交都会在本地仓库中创建一个新的提交记录,记录当前工作目录中的代码状态。二、使用流程 在使用git commit之前,通常需要先使用git add命令将修改的文件添加到暂存区。 然后,通过git commit命令,
前言作为一个在青青草原上的灰太狼, 日常独自使用 git版本管理工具时 , 大部分时候都是两眼一闭, 直接在main branch上一键三连add+commit+push. 正经和别人协作时, 就会发现自己的git知识属实是弟弟级别的. 今天来…
一、 push 到远程仓库后,又想补充文件。 1. 提交要补充的文件 1 gti add 要补充的文件 2. 修改 commit 1 git commit --amend 注意: 一定要用 --amend 参数 3. 强制推送到远程仓库(云端) 1 git push -f origin dev//-f 和 --force 作用是相同的 注意:本地多分支的时候,一定要确认你本地所在的分...
1、将本地缓存区中的修改提交到本地仓库 : git commit 使用方法: git commit -m"提交说明": 将add到缓存区的全部修改提交到本次仓库 注意: 使用git log 命令可以查看全部commit历史信息。 commit命令会记录一条log,生成当前分支上的一个log节点(即一个版本),commit的一个个版本形成分支的生命线。 二、本地...
git commit push 命令是 Git 版本控制系统中的一条组合命令,用于将本地代码提交(commit)到版本库,并推送(push)到远程仓库。 具体而言,用法为: “`git commit -m “commit message” && git push“` 其中,`-m`选项用于指定提交信息(commit message),用于描述当前提交的更改内容。 这条命令的执行过程如下: 1...
05. 添加到暂存区git add 添加单个文件: 复制 git add <文件名> 1. 添加全部更改: 复制 git add . 1. 06. 撤销暂存git reset 还没提交的内容想“退回去”: 复制 git reset <文件名> 1. 07. 提交更改git commit 正式提交暂存区的更改,并写上备注: ...
步骤二:提交解决后的文件 使用git add <文件>将解决冲突后的文件添加到暂存区。 使用git commit提交已经解决冲突的文件,并在提交信息中描述解决冲突的操作和结果。步骤三:完成合并 使用git push将更改推送到远程仓库,完成合并操作。详细解释:Git中的冲突通常发生在合并分支或推送分支到远程仓库时,当...
2. 撤销已经commit,但是没有push到远端的文件(仅撤销commit 保留add操作) 撤销上一次的提交 git reset --soft HEAD^ 1. windows 系统使用提示 more,需要多加一个 ^(windows当中^才是换行符?) git reset --soft HEAD^^ 1. 按照输入的数字撤销输入数字条commit记录 ...
git add . 1. 或 git add -A 1. 根据ignore的配置,添加跟踪文件,其中的.或-A表示添加所有更改过的文件。 2.查看状态 git status 1. 3.提交到本地: git commit -m "说明" 1. 引号内为本次提交的说明文字。如果说明文字很长需要换行,则用单引号来换行,如: ...
$ git checkout HEAD^ myfile $ git add -A $ git commit --amend 这将非常有用,当你有一个开放的补丁(open patch),你往上面提交了一个不必要的文件,你需要强推(force push)去更新这个远程补丁。 我想删除我的的最后一次提交(commit) 如果你需要删除推了的提交(pushed commits),你可以使用下面的方法。